How can I get Snipping tools im using Vista and this control panel and then enable or disable the thing pc isn't here. Help?
Hello
You don't say which edition of Vista you are using.
Vista Home Basic Edition does not have the "snipping tool".
If you have a different edition of Vista, read the information on how to find it:
http://www.PCWorld.com/article/137099/activate_vistas_snipping_tool.html
If you have one version of Vista, other than the Home Basic edition, you already have the Snipping Tool screenshot utility: click on Start, all programs, accessories, Snipping Tool. If you do not see here, it cannot be activated. Go to the Control Panel and open programs and features (you may need to click programs first). In the left pane, click Windows turn features on or off. If necessary, click continue when you are prompted by user account control. Scroll down the list of features, check the box next to Tablet PC optional components, and click OK. Marketing of these features gives you not only the Snipping Tool, but also input panel Tablet PC, Windows Journal and other features related to the stylus.

HP Officejet 4500 wireless printer does not appear on the control panel
My HP Officejet 4500 wireless printer does not appear on the control panel. How to fix it. I have a laptop Toshiba and Windows 7 Home Premium OS. Help, please. rwillm
Hey,.
Thanks for the update, rwillm. It seems that the installation of the printer can be a little messed up. If the printer software is always installed, but simply lacks the printer, then I would advise to do a little cleaning before choosing to add the printer back.
- Make sure that the printer is deleted from the file devices and printers
- Click on one of the remaining printers folder
- Select the properties of the print server at the top of the window
- Click the tab drivers
- Remove all drivers in this window for the Officejet 4500
Also check in the Device Manager to verify that there is no mention of remaining of the 4500.
- Click on the start menu
- Right click on computer
- Select manage in the list
- Click Device Manager in the list of questions on the left side of the window that opens
- Click the view at the top of the menu, and then select Show hidden devices
- Remove all references to the 4500 in the list of devices
After making sure of the device is gone, I recommend bike devices in the power circuit: router, computer and printer.
* Make sure the printer has a valid IP address after switching back on and is connected to the same network as your PC before adding the printer.
If the IP address and SSID are good for the printer, then try to add the printer with the printer software, you have installed.
- Click on the Start Menu
- Click on all programs
- Open the HP folder
- Open the folder for the series of the Officejet 4500 G510
- Select Add a device option
